Bezos creates AI startup where he will be co-CEO

JEFF BEZOS, THE founder of Amazon and one of the world's wealthiest people, is throwing his money and time into an artificial intelligence startup that he will help manage as its co-chief executive.
The company, called Project Prometheus, is coming out of the gates with $6.2 billion in funding, partly from Bezos, making it one of the most wellfinanced early-stage startups in the world, said three people familiar with the company who spoke on condition of anonymity because details have not yet been made public.
This is the first time Bezos has taken a formal operational role in a company since he stepped down as chief executive of Amazon in July 2021. Though he is deeply involved in Blue Origin, a competitor to Elon Musk's SpaceX, his official title at the space company is founder.
